Output fadc7d2db5ef840701d7ea865f50a94926a2511c7aae1e6013f136e70f8c87fa:2

value
137541601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bddce1db77593a7ac8d67f0d488c4311d5103ffa OP_EQUAL
address
3JzvEy64J63pDv7KjyKsVzupMgKcwdgQU4
transaction
fadc7d2db5ef840701d7ea865f50a94926a2511c7aae1e6013f136e70f8c87fa
confirmations
330673
spent
true